Some of the most common reasons people need garage door repair in Clute, Texas are listed here:
Garage Door Won't Open or Shut

A garage door that won't open or shut might be from a variety of different problems including broken springs or cables, broken or misaligned sensors, or a damaged garage door opener. Our Clute garage door pros can do an inspection to determine the reason and get it fixed for you.

Damaged Garage Door Springs

Broken springs are a common complaint which arises after a lot of use.  We can assist with torsion or extension spring maintenance, replacing broken springs, or performing spring adjustment for residential or business properties.  We can also help with both torque master and torsion springs.

Broken Garage Door Hinges

Hardware and hinges can wear out with frequent use.  Broken hinges can injure the garage door and make it difficult to open.  If you spot broken hinges, get them fixed as soon as possible to prevent additional damage.

Garage door clickers

Garage door controllers can break down over time.  Sometimes a simple battery replacement can fix it, but other times you might need a new remote to be set up.  Our Clute garage door contractors can repair and program remotes, set up car remotes, and also put in outside garage door keypads.

Garage Door Banging Noise

Banging noises are often caused by unbalanced doors.  It's best to get this issue addressed sooner rather than later to keep other damage from happening.

Weather Stripping Repair

As your garage door ages, the weather stripping or trim may deteriorate and need repair.  Replacing the weather stripping will help insulate your garage and keep unwanted critters out.

Rattling Garage Door Sounds

Rattling sounds may be the result of loose nuts or bolts, dry parts needing lubrication , misaligned doors, or a garage door opener that was not correctly installed.

Garage Door Scraping Noises

Scraping noises are sometimes the result of unbalanced doors.

Squeaking Garage Door

Squeaking noises might be due to a loose roller or hinge, parts needing lubrication, or unbalanced doors.

Rubbing Sound Garage Door

Rubbing could be caused by bent tracks or a jammed or tight track which needs fixing.

Grinding Noise Garage Door

Grinding sounds may be caused by parts needing oiling, loose rollers or hinges, a stripped garage door opener gear, or an incorrectly installed opener.

Slapping Garage Door Noise

Slapping noises are sometimes caused by a loose chain.

Vibrating Garage Door Noise

Vibrating sounds are frequently caused by loose parts or rollers needing grease.

Popping Sound Garage Door

Popping noises could be caused by torsion spring problems.

Garage Door Opener Installation

The average life of a garage door opener is approximately 10-15 years. Routine upkeep, lubrication, and checking that your garage door is balanced will increase the lifespan of your opener. For safety reasons, if you have a garage door opener which was built before 1993, it’s always advisable to have it replaced instead of fixed. New Garage Doors

After you have done multiple repairs or maintenance service on your garage door, if it is still not working correctly, then it might be time to think about replacing the garage door completely. Newer doors have a full range of benefits, including bettering the curb appeal of your house and increasing home values and adding improved security and safeguards. New garage doors are equipped with the most up to date safety and security standards to keep your family and belongings safe. Newer doors additionally provide superior insulation and might aid in regulating the temperature of your home's interior and also make the garage space more climate controlled.
